Abstract
We have calculated the form-factors F and G in K → ππlν decays (K(l4)) to two-loop order in Chiral Perturbation Theory (ChPT). Combining this together with earlier two-loop calculations an updated set of values for the L(i)/(r), the ChPT constants at O(p4), is obtained. We discuss the uncertainties in the determination and the changes compared to previous estimates. (C) 2000 Elsevier Science B.V.
